Ben: Did you go to the museum last week?
Emma: Yes, I did. I saw a skeleton of a T-rex.
Ben: Wow! Is a T-rex larger than a whale?
Emma: No. A T-rex is smaller than a whale. Some whales can be over 30 meters long, while a T-rex was about 12 meters long.
Ben: What about weight?
Emma: Whales are heavier, too! But there's an interesting fact: a T-rex's teeth are sharper than a whale's teeth!
Ben: Really?
Emma: Yes. It had sharp teeth for eating meat.
Ben: Wow, that's cool! I really want to go to the museum and see it for myself!
